				Sci-Fi Psychological Thrillers?
			 
			
			
			One of my favorite movies of all time is Primer.  If you haven't seen it, you need to watch it.  20 times.  It will change your life. 
		
	
		
		
		
		
		
		
		
		
		
		
	
	In short, it deals with Time Travel, paradoxes, etc. and it's done in a very unique and realistic way. If you HAVE read it, can you recommend any good books that are similar. I saw that Shane Carruth said he read "our elegant universe" in preparing to make the film - but that's more technical reading I think. I've already read a doorway into summer by Robert Heinlein which was a great complimentary read, but need more recommendations.  |

			For SF Psychological thrillers the first one that pops into my head is The Demolished Man by  Alfred Bester.
